Walk With Me

I am tired, but will walk a while I think that I will walk a mile The leafy lane with hedges new Birds singing there high in the blue Of gravel sounds ringing gruff It’s fun to kick and more to scuff The style with its twisted wood Beckons me as it only could I raise my feelings jumping high The meadow has caught my eye Flowers that say hello to me Daisies laugh the buttercups sigh The grass a blanket where I could lie I now am floating as a Honey bee The meadow dips, the stream I see It holds the water there for me Meandering through village and farms For me though it just drifts along Holding,Oh! Soft summer’s song There I wander for time stands still I'll sit here a while to heal my ills Breeze caressing my thoughts today Warm and soft I hope they stay I need you there to make me well In my mind where I dwell I am now refreshed somehow I have returned to the now My thoughts did wander so
